Linuxの 'cat' コマンドを使いこなそう!【2024年最新完全ガイド】
なぜ今さら 'cat' コマンド?
'cat' コマンドは、Linuxでのファイル操作に欠かせない定番コマンドです。しかし、その機能は「ファイル内容を表示するだけ」にとどまらず、多くの人が知らない便利な応用術が詰まっています。
本記事では、'cat' の基本から、効率的な操作を可能にする応用例、さらにはLinux環境で最大限活用するためのヒントまで、幅広く解説します。さらに、Linuxサーバーを快適に使うためのおすすめVPSも紹介。これを読めば、あなたのLinuxライフが格段に変わるはずです!
'cat' コマンドの基本から応用まで
基本操作
-
ファイルの内容を表示
ファイルを簡単に確認するには:cat filename.txt
-
新しいファイルを作成
テキストを直接入力して保存できます。cat > newfile.txt
Ctrl+Dで終了。
-
複数ファイルの結合
複数ファイルを1つにまとめる操作も簡単:cat file1.txt file2.txt > combined.txt
知らないと損する!'cat' の応用技
-
行番号を表示
ファイルの内容に行番号を付与:cat -n filename.txt
-
空行を抑制
余分な空行を削除して見やすく整理:cat -s filename.txt
-
非表示文字の確認
改行やタブなどの非表示文字を確認:cat -vte filename.txt
-
リアルタイムログ確認
'tail' や 'grep' と組み合わせることで、ログ解析も可能:cat /var/log/syslog | grep "error"
VPS選びも重要!おすすめVPSサービス2選
Linuxを活用するなら、信頼できるVPSが必要不可欠です。以下におすすめのVPSを2つご紹介します。
LightNode
1.- 特徴: 高性能なVPSをお手頃価格で提供。初心者にも優しい管理パネルが魅力。
-
メリット:
- グローバル40拠点で低遅延を実現。
- 時間課金制で柔軟な利用が可能。
🎉 特典: 1 vCPU → 2 vCPU 無料アップグレード を実施中。対象地域にてご利用いただける限定プロモーションです。
ConoHa VPS
2.- 特徴: 日本国内向けの高速で安定したVPSサービス。
-
メリット:
- 国内データセンターを活用した高いパフォーマンス。
- シンプルで直感的な管理画面。
'cat' を極めるためのヒント
-
大容量ファイルには注意
メモリを大量に消費するため、非常に大きなファイルには 'less' を使用。 -
ファイル編集には適さない
'cat' は閲覧や作成に向いていますが、編集には 'vim' や 'nano' を使用するのがおすすめ。 -
コマンドの組み合わせ
他のコマンドと組み合わせることで、さらに効率的に使えます。
cat file.txt | grep "pattern" | sort | uniq -c
Linux環境を効率的に操作するスキルは、日常の作業を大きく変える力を持っています。'cat'コマンドのような基礎的なツールを深く理解し、実践に活かすことで、よりシンプルかつ生産的なワークフローを実現できるでしょう。また、クラウドベースのインフラやサーバー技術を活用することで、柔軟性と拡張性を兼ね備えた運用環境を構築できます。今後の成長を見据え、常に学び続ける姿勢と、新しいツールや技術への挑戦を恐れない心構えが、未来の可能性を広げる鍵となるはずです。
Discussion